Firefighters extinguish a fire, after a blast hit a chemical plant in the northern German city of Ritterhude, early September 10, 2014. The blast hit the chemical plant late Tuesday and damaged several nearby buildings, police said. Officials did not evacuate nearby residential buildings after the explosion at around 1830 GMT, said police spokesman Marcus Neumann in the district of Osterholz. The residents in the street directly beside the burning chemical plant were advised to leave their homes for the night voluntarily as a precaution.
